From 2024 to 2028, the re-import value of articles containing magnesite, dolomite, or chromite to Canada is forecasted to increase annually, from $13.57 thousand in 2024 to $14.94 thousand in 2028. This reflects an overall positive trend with an approximate comp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 2.4%, indicating steady demand and market resilience.
Future trends to watch for include potential fluctuations in global commodity prices, which could impact cost structures, and any changes in trade agreements or tariffs that might affect the import dynamics. Additionally, technological advancements in material applications could alter demand patterns.
